Overviews the field and discusses trends in gerontology from a social science perspective, for students in the helping professions. Sections on theoretical perspectives on aging; the individual and the social system; adjustment patterns; and societal issues cover psychological changes in later life, aging minority group members, attitudes toward death, the economics of aging, and service delivery systems.
